In this episode, Paul talks with Diane about why lasting change requires more than motivation and discipline.

They explore how the nervous system influences behavior, why what we call “self-sabotage” is often self-protection, and how identity shapes long-term habits.

Topics include:

  • A practical definition of self-awareness

  • Why most of our behavior is habitual

  • The difference between “wanting to want” and true desire

  • How the brain hijack shuts down logic

  • Why affirmations fail without belief

  • The “thought ladder” approach to sustainable mindset shifts

  • Using visualization to build identity

A grounded, compassionate framework for anyone struggling to make change stick.
